> > I was able to setup the pitfdll plugin for gstreamer and use the win32
> > codecs under fc5 with selinux enabled. The pitfdll plugin needed to be
> > marked textrel_shlib_t and the codecs under /usr/lib/win32 marked lib_t.
> > This worked for FC5 under selinux and FC6 with selinux disabled. But
> > selinux under FC6 seems to have changed. Is their another lable I
> > should use, how can I debug this?

> Aug 9 19:12:34 soncomputer kernel: audit(1155165152.723:10): avc:
> denied { execstack } for pid=9530 comm="totem"
> scontext=user_u:system_r:unconfined_t:s0
> tcontext=user_u:system_r:unconfined_t:s0 tclass=process
>
> -Louis
you can turn on allow_execstack or change the context of totem to
unconfined_execmen_exec_t
chcon -t unconfined_execmem_exec_t /usr/bin/totem
if I turn on allow_execstack would that be for everything or just for totem?
What would be the most secure of these two options?
